隨筆-46  評(píng)論-64  文章-2  trackbacks-0

          可以用下面這個(gè)方法來(lái)做到

          import ?org.apache.log4j.Logger;
          import ?org.apache.log4j.PropertyConfigurator;

          public ? class ?DemoRunTimeChangeLog4J? {

          ?
          private ? static ? final ?Logger?logger? = ?Logger.getLogger(DemoRunTimeChangeLog4J. class );

          ?
          public ? static ? void ?main(String[]?args)? {
          ??PropertyConfigurator.configureAndWatch(
          " src/log4j.configureAndWatch " , 60000 );
          ??
          ??
          while ?( true )? {
          ???
          if ?(logger.isDebugEnabled())? {
          ????logger.debug(
          " DEBUG?MESSAGE " );
          ???}


          ???logger.info(
          " Info?Message " );

          ???
          try ? {
          ????Thread.sleep(
          5000 );
          ???}
          ? catch ?(InterruptedException?e)? {
          ???}

          ??}

          ?}

          }


          posted on 2008-09-03 17:35 jht 閱讀(642) 評(píng)論(0)  編輯  收藏 所屬分類: J2SE
          主站蜘蛛池模板: 稷山县| 璧山县| 甘南县| 靖宇县| 松江区| 观塘区| 澄迈县| 西和县| 甘南县| 通辽市| 利津县| 望城县| 凤山县| 罗定市| 鹿邑县| 武宣县| 大余县| 甘孜| 绵阳市| 慈利县| 隆尧县| 玉屏| 陆河县| 嵊泗县| 文化| 师宗县| 扎囊县| 右玉县| 新乡县| 阿克| 新巴尔虎右旗| 彭山县| 桐乡市| 佛冈县| 尉犁县| 东海县| 乐平市| 班戈县| 广南县| 巴青县| 隆回县|